Sindhi cuisine is very nutritious with a predominant use of vegetables in each and every dish. Sindhi kadhi is one such example where all the vegetables are used beautifully to complement each other in taste, colour and texture.

Ingredients:
Yam 50 Grams
Potatoes 50 Grams
Pumpkin 75 Grams
Drum sticks 1 Numbers
Okra 3 Numbers
Coriander powder 1 Bunch
Chilly powder 1 Tablespoons
Turmeric 1/4 Teaspoons
Green chilly chopped 3 Numbers
Chopped ginger 1 Teaspoons
Curry leaves 2 Springs
Fenugreek seeds 1/4 Teaspoons
Cumin seeds 1 Teaspoons
Oil 3 Tablespoons
Chick pea flour 85 Grams
Carrot 1 Numbers
Beans 8 Numbers
Tomatoes 3 Numbers
Egg plant 2 Numbers
Tamarind juice 1/2 Cup
Jaggery 2 Tablespoons
Chopped coriander 1 Bunch
Directions:
1. Heat oil in a pan add chick pea flour roast the flour in a slow flame till raw flavor is gone and it is almost red , switch off the flame and add water mix it well.
2. Heat oil in another pan add cumin seeds, fenugreek seeds, curry leaves, hing, chopped ginger, green chilly, turmeric, and add okra, drum sticks, pumpkin, potatoes, yam, carrot, beans, saut this, and add chilly powder, coriander powder, add water, and chick pea flour mixture cook it for 10 minutes.
3. After that add tomatoes, egg plant, salt, tamarind juice, cook it for few minutes, add jaggery, salt, chopped coriander.
4. Serve this hot with rice.

Evening meals affect overnight insulin and morning blood sugar more than most women realise. Keeping dinner protein-forward and finishing eating at least 2-3 hours before bed gives your body time to clear glucose before the overnight fast, which improves morning fasting insulin readings.
